Prowler V6-3.5L VIN G (1999)
Rear Knuckle: Service and Repair
Removal
NOTE: When removing the center cap from the wheel do not use a sharp or hard tool. Use of such a tool can damage the finish on the wheel and
damage the center cap.
1. Remove the center cap from the wheel. Center cap is removed by inserting a trim stick into the notch on the center cap and prying it off the wheel.
2. With the weight of the vehicle supported by the tires and the parking brake applied, loosen but do not remove the stub shaft to hub bearing nut.
3. Release park brake before raising vehicle.
4. Raise the vehicle on jackstands or centered on a frame contact type hoist.
5. Remove the wheel and tire.
